Nenadi Usman Faction Tells Datti Baba-Ahmed Supreme Court Settled Labour Party Leadership

The Nenadi Usman-led faction of the Labour Party has reminded the party’s 2023 Vice Presidential candidate, Dr. Datti Baba-Ahmed, that the party’s leadership crisis has been conclusively resolved by the Supreme Court.
In a statement issued in Abuja on Wednesday, Ken Asogwa, Senior Special Adviser (Media) to the party’s Interim National Chairman, Senator Nenadi Usman, responded to Baba-Ahmed’s recent recognition of Julius Abure as National Chairman during a public event.
“It is imperative to state that the leadership question within the Labour Party has been conclusively settled by the Supreme Court of Nigeria,” Asogwa said.
He pointed out that the party took note of Baba-Ahmed’s participation in a meeting organized by the Abure-led faction, describing such actions as inconsistent with the court’s clear ruling.
According to Asogwa, the apex court’s judgment explicitly nullified Julius Abure’s claim to the chairmanship and affirmed Senator Usman’s leadership, granting her all the reliefs sought in the appeal.
He called on members of the party to remain calm, focused, and united as efforts continue to reconcile aggrieved members and strengthen the party’s internal cohesion.
